摘要

The study’s objectives were to assess diagnostic stability of initial autism spectrum disorder (ASD) diagnoses in community settings and identify factors associated with diagnostic instability using data from a national Web-based autism registry. A Cox proportional hazards model was used to assess the relative risk of change in initial ASD diagnosis as a function of demographic characteristics, diagnostic subtype, environmental factors and natural history. Autistic disorder was the most stable initial diagnosis; pervasive developmental disorder—not otherwise specified was the least stable. Additional factors such as diagnosing clinician, region, when in time a child was initially diagnosed, and history of autistic regression also were significantly associated with diagnostic stability in community settings. Findings suggest that the present classification system and other secular factors may be contributing to increasing instability of community-assigned labels of ASD.
机译:这项研究的目的是评估社区环境中初始自闭症谱系障碍(ASD)诊断的诊断稳定性,并使用基于国家网络的自闭症注册中心的数据,确定与诊断不稳定性相关的因素。使用Cox比例风险模型评估初始ASD诊断中变化的相对风险,该风险是人口统计学特征,诊断亚型,环境因素和自然史的函数。自闭症是最稳定的初始诊断。广泛性发育障碍-除非另有说明,否则最不稳定。其他因素,例如诊断临床医生,地区,最初诊断为儿童的时间以及自闭症的消退史,也与社区环境的诊断稳定性显着相关。研究结果表明,当前的分类系统和其他世俗因素可能会加剧由社区分配的ASD标签的不稳定性。
